Golden State Warriors guard Klay Thompson has been one of the best shooters in the NBA today, especially from beyond the arc, where he has made 41.9 percent of his attempts. However on Monday, he showed off another talent that he has, and impressed the crowd, and even the commentators covering the game.

The three-time All-Star was in attendance during the baseball game between the San Francisco Giants and Oakland Athletics, and was tasked to deliver the first pitch on the afternoon. While there have been a number of other professional athletes who have failed miserably on it in the past, Thompson delivered a very impressive one, that left many in awe.

The 27-year-old comes from a family of athletes, as his dad won a couple of championships during his playing days with the Los Angeles Lakers, and also has a brother, Trayce, who plays for the Los Angeles Dodgers as an outfielder. That said, it could explain why he has the right form and ability to throw that kind of pitch.
